开篇:在链上可见性与隐私需求不断拉扯的今天,TPWallet 的“隐藏资产”不是简单的余额掩盖,而是通过密钥派生、交易构造与网络层隔离三位一体来实现可控隐匿。下面以技术指南的口吻,分步骤说明实现原理与安全实践。
一、架构与核心要素

1) HD钱包(BIP32/39/44)作为根基:使用助记词生成主密钥(xprv/xpub),通过分层派生在逻辑上隔离账户与子账户,便于将“隐藏账户”与常规账户独立管理。2) 节点钱包:全节点提供完整交易验证、UTXO控制与广播接口,避免依赖第三方 API,引入 Tor/WHIRLPOOL 等网络层匿名化。3) 智能支付技术:借助支付通道(如 Lightning)、HTLC 与原子交换,将资金移动交由链下协议,减少链上痕迹。
二、隐藏资产实现流程(实践步骤)
1) 初始化:在离线环境生成助记词并导入硬件安全模块(HSM/TEE),建立主密钥并标注隐藏账户范围。2) 派生:为隐藏账户使用独立派生路径(purpose/index),并可采用一次性隐形地址(stealth/BIP47)或单次子地址。3) UTXO/余额隔离:通过 coin-control 精确选择输出,避免合并普通和隐藏 UTXO;必要时使用 CoinJoin 或 Confidential Transactions 混淆来源与数额。4) 签名与广播:签名在 HSM/TEE 或离线机器完成,广播经由自建节点并走 Tor、VPN 与分布式中继,防止流量分析。5) 支付与结算:推荐优先链下结算,使用闪电通道或多方计算(MPC)签名实现无单点私钥暴露的支付流程。
三、先进安全与高科技突破
引入门槛技术包括阈签名/MPC(消除单一私钥风险)、零知识证明(隐藏金额与收款方)、同态加密与可信执行环境(确保签名与策略在受控环境执行)。这些技术将使隐藏资产既能保有可审计性又具隐私性。

结语:TPWallet 的隐藏资产能力依赖层次化密钥管理、节点自主性以及链上/链下协同https://www.cqmfbj.net ,。实践中应以分层隔离、最小暴露、硬件根信任与可验证协议为原则,逐步引入 MPC 与 ZK 技术以提升隐私与合规间的平衡。